<span style="font-size:18px;">//冒泡排序
$arr=array(2,1,3,6,5,4,8,7,9,15,12,16);
$n=count($arr);
for ($i=0; $i <$n-1; $i++) {
for ($j=0; $j <$n-$i-1 ; $j++) {
if($arr[$j]>$arr[$j+1]){
$t=$arr[$j];
$arr[$j]=$arr[$j+1];
$arr[$j+1]=$t;
}
}
}
show_bug($arr);
//选择排序
$arr2=array(23,5,26,4,9,85,10,2,55,44,21,39,11,16,55,88,421,226);
$num=count($arr2);
for ($a=0; $a <$n ; $a++) {
for ($b=$a; $b<$n-$a ; $b++) {
if($arr2[$a]>$arr2[$b]){
$t=$arr2[$a];
$arr2[$a]=$arr2[$b];
$arr2[$b]=$t;
}
}
}
show_bug($arr2);</span>
php 简单冒泡排序和选择排序
最新推荐文章于 2022-01-28 10:23:11 发布